Coquet Island is a small island of about 6 hectares, situated 1.2 kilometres off Amble on the Northumberland coast, northeast England. Owing to its importance for roseate terns, Coquet Island is a wildlife sanctuary and the public are not allowed to visit. -

Coquet Island has been an RSPB nature reserve since 1970 and is a site of Special Scientific Interest and therefore protected all year round. Puffins arrive on the waters around Coquet Island, towards the end of March and will leave the island along with their pufflings, at the end of July. -

The puffin festival has been inspired by the colony of approximately 20,000 puffins that nest on the RSPB seabird sanctuary of Coquet Island, just a mile off Amble. Coquet Island has been an RSPB nature reserve since 1970 and is also the sole UK nesting colony of roseate terns.

- Summary: Coquet Island Holiday Search Discover Beautiful Coquet Island Lying just one mile off the coast at Amble, Coquet Island is an RSPB nature reserve. It is a safe haven for over 30,000 pairs of seabirds, some who travel from Africa to nest there. The island is protected under European Law for birds such as the roseate tern, one of our rarest nesting seabirds. Coquet Island now holds 90% of the UK’s roseate tern population.
